Definitions from Wikipedia (Rumpole of the Bailey)
▸ noun: a British television series created and written by the British writer and barrister John Mortimer.
▸ noun: a 1978 collection of short stories by John Mortimer about defence barrister Horace Rumpole.
▸ noun: a radio series created and written by the British writer and barrister John Mortimer based on the television series Rumpole of the Bailey.
▸ noun: a series of books created and written by the British writer and barrister John Mortimer based on the television series Rumpole of the Bailey.
